The Shaikh Khalifa Specialty Hospital in Ras Al Khaimah has opened orthopedics, ENT and ophthalmology departments.
The hospital has also purchased advanced testing equipment including the one for DNA testing, according to Dr Myung-Whun Sung, CEO of the hospital.
"The Hospital, committed to achieving patients' need also opens new departments, provides modern services and supports the services of its three excellence centres: cardiovascular, neurology and oncology."
Official figures show that the Hospital received 22,000 patients in the outpatient clinics and emergency department during the first half of the year.
"There is a significant rise in the number of patients at the outpatient sections and emergency departments since the beginning of the year," he said.
The number of outpatients has enormously increased from 4,300 in last year to 13,625 over the same period this year, he added.
"The emergency section opened in the second half of last year has received 8,680 patients this year so far whereas 1,168 patients were hospitalised from January to June this year as compared to 435 last year."
Up to 400 complicated surgeries were performed in comparison to 100 in the first half of last year, he said, attributing the rise to the high standards in the hospital.
